Basic mobility scooters are an affordable option for those who require assistance with mobility due to health issues. They are usually cheaper than powered chairs and can be used on terrains that are rough. They're not a replacement for wheelchairs and should only be used when other aids to mobility such as walkers, crutches or even stair lifts aren't working.

The basic characteristics of a mobility scooter include a throttle, tiller lights, indicators, and the Horn. The tiller controls direction and is usually adjustable to suit individual comfort. A horn is a crucial safety feature that alerts other motorists of the presence of the scooter especially when driving in pedestrian zones. The lights on the scooter are vital to be visible at night and in low-light conditions. They can also be used to inform other motorists of the intention of the rider to turn.

An indicator is an electronic device that indicates the speed of a scooter. These are often placed on the control panel and can vary in form and design, with some featuring visual representations while others have more traditional gauges. Some scooters come with a wigwag function that allows users to control forward and reverse movement by applying different pressures to the throttle button.

A few basic mobility scooters can fold or dismantled, which could be helpful when transporting the device. It is essential to think about the place you'll store the device. If possible it should be located near an electrical socket for easy charging. A storage cover can keep your scooter safe and clean from the elements.

Size

When shopping for scooters, it is essential to be aware of the scooter's dimensions. This will ensure that the scooter is suitable for your home's doors and other limitations of the environment. The scooter's dimensions also influence the user experience and safety. A scooter that's too small could cause discomfort or even injury, whereas larger models could be difficult to maneuver around certain areas.

Accessories such as cup holders and baskets can also affect the size of the motorized scooter. These accessories increase the overall dimensions of the scooter, while enhancing the user experience. Furthermore the kind of battery used can impact the overall dimensions of a scooter as well. Sealed lead-acid batteries are typically heavier and thicker than lithium-ion ones.

Many manufacturers make folding wheelchairs that are lightweight which can be conveniently stored in tight spaces or in the trunks of cars. These mobility scooters are ideal for a trip to the shop or an afternoon in the park with family and friends.

Three-wheeled scooters have a narrower base and a shorter turning radius than four-wheeled ones, which makes them better suited for navigate tighter spaces such as narrow shop aisles or between furniture at home. On the other side, four-wheeled scooters are more suitable for outdoor terrain because they are more stable and have a bigger base.

On the instrument panel of most scooters, there is a charge bar that indicates the distance you can travel before you have to recharge your battery. However, this may differ according to the type of terrain you are traveling over as well as the weight of the scooter and its accessories, as well as the speed at which you are driving.

Weight

The weight of a mobility scooter is a major factor for owners. Weight can affect everything from maneuverability to portability and durability of components.

The weight of a scooter may differ greatly based on its frame material and dimensions. Aluminum is the most popular material for frame frames for mobility scooters due to of its light weight properties. However, steel has greater durability. Some manufacturers are even using carbon fibre to lower the weight of their scooters, without sacrificing strength and durability.

Another important factor that affects scooter weight is the type of seat and other accessories. Cup baskets, holders, mobile device and oxygen holders all add to the total weight of a scooter. But, it's important to remember that many of these items can be easily removed or reattached to reduce the weight of your mobility scooter.

The nature of the battery and its power source can also affect the weight of the mobility scooter. Sealed lead-acid (SLA) batteries are generally larger and heavier than lithium-ion batteries. This could make a huge difference in the weight of mobility scooters.

The method of transport and the destination could affect a scooter's overall weight. Mobility scooters that fold can be easy to store and be tucked away in tighter spaces. They are also lighter than nonfolding counterparts. Alternatively, scooters that cannot be disassembled could require the assistance of an auto lift for transport. It is recommended to weigh your scooter before buying it. This way, you can be confident that it meets your requirements and is easy to lift or transport. Travel Distance

It is important to be aware of the distance you will be able to travel on a single battery charge if you plan to read more use a scooter as local transportation. You don't have to be stranded in a location and not be able to return home because your battery is dead.

The distance the scooter can travel on the charge is determined by several factors. These include the weight of the rider, the terrain, and the speed at which it is driven. The scooter will require more power to move heavier riders which can reduce the distance it is able to travel on a single battery charge. The battery could also be drained more quickly when you go up steep hills or on rough terrain.

Scooter accessories like baskets and lights add weight to the scooter, which reduces the range of its drive. To extend the range of the scooter, it is best to eliminate any unnecessary accessories.

A slower speed can also increase the distance that the scooter can travel. Comfort

It is important to consider comfort as a factor to consider when purchasing an ordinary mobility device. These scooters are designed to be comfortable for the user, and come with comfortable seats and adjustable armrests. They also let the user operate their scooter with ease and without stress.

This is crucial, particularly when you intend to make long distances or on rough terrain. A comfortable and well-padded seat is vital for comfort and back support. It's also a good choice to select an electric best pavement mobility scooter scooter with a captain seat (usually found on larger scooters). This lets the user adjust their position and provides extra support.

Another important aspect to consider is the amount of storage space available on a mobility scooter that is basic. A walker, rollator, or wheelchair is capable of transporting personal items, but they are not made to carry the typical items you'll find on an outing to the shops. The most basic mobility scooters generally have basket storage, and behind and under seat storage options. Some models might even include a walking stick or umbrella holder.

The type of battery used in the basic mobility scooter must be considered. The majority of scooters are powered by lithium batteries, which are lighter than lead acid batteries and provide more info a longer range. Lithium batteries don't also have as much of an impact on the environment.
